The equation isn't like 2+2=4 because weight loss isn't linear & everyone is different. But the basic concept is still a basic math equation... It's like one of those "if this, then that" type of equations. If CI < CO, then weight loss occurs. If you think about it that way, That equation is consistent. Every time.
